Section 338(3)
POCA 2002
Proceeds of Crime Act 2002 · United Kingdom
The third condition is that— the disclosure is made after the alleged offender does the prohibited act, he has a reasonable excuse for his failure to make the disclosure before he did the act, and the disclosure is made on his own initiative and as soon as it is practicable for him to make it.
